Career path
| Career Role in Advanced Gaming Voiceover Acting (UK) | Description |
|---|---|
| Lead Voice Actor (Video Games) | Perform principal character voices, embodying diverse personalities and emotions. High demand for exceptional vocal range and acting skills. |
| Supporting Voice Actor (Games & Trailers) | Provide voices for secondary characters, narrations, or background ambiance. Strong vocal versatility and adaptability are key. |
| Voice Director (Gaming Projects) | Oversee voice recording sessions, guide actors, and ensure high-quality audio production. Extensive experience and leadership skills required. |
| Character Voice Specialist (RPGs & MMORPGs) | Specialise in delivering believable and engaging voices for unique game characters within a specific genre. Excellent improvisation skills beneficial. |
| Audio Engineer (Voiceover Post-Production) | Edit and mix voice recordings, ensuring audio clarity and consistency across gaming projects. Technical expertise and audio editing software knowledge essential. |
